Subject: Quickstore 4.2 — bloom filter now fronts the KV layer

Plugin authors: starting with this release, Quickstore places a bloom filter ahead of the key-value store. Negative lookups return faster; false positives fall through safely. No API changes are required on your side. Verify your plugin against the staging build referenced below.

session token of fahif-tadup = htk3_9c7

Ticket #4412 — Log sampler creds expired again. Heads up: the sampling agent for Chirpwell (yes, the chatty one that floods Logbarn with debug spam) stopped shipping samples overnight because its credentials lapsed. Sampling rate config is untouched, so once auth works it should resume at 5%. I minted a fresh key for the sampler so support can re-apply it on the collector box. Use the key below.

app token of bahaf-tajeg = zpat23_SjjsllwiLmXbtS65veZaV47

Ticket 982: Vault locked again

Hey — the StockMend reconciliation job can't start because its secrets vault auto-sealed during the patch window. Nothing scary, just bad timing before Friday's release cut. Can you unseal it before the 6pm run so the counts land in the release report? You'll need the recovery passphrase, which is right below.

vault phrase of bagaf-kajeg = jorath-feniel-briir-siliel-ralix